Resumo:
In this work it was developed a rainfall infiltrometer, it presents some precipitation characteristics such as diameter distribution and cinetic energy of raindrops closely related to the natural rainfall. From the results, it was concluded that: a) the water precipitation distribution uniformity expressed by Christiansen’s uniformity coefficient presented values varying from 82% to 87%; b) the ratio between the cinetic energy from simulated rainfall and the cinetic energy from natural rainfall was above 90% for precipitation intensities up to 100 mm h-1.
